Abolish Motorcycle license A2 to A test requirement
In the past (prior to 2013), an A2 license holder would be restricted to two years before achieving a full A category unrestricted motorcycle license without an additional test. We propose it returns to that scheme.
We propose reinstating automatic upgrades from A2 to A motorcycle licenses after two years, as was the case pre-2013. This change reduces test centre backlogs, supports green transport by promoting motorcycle use, and eliminates redundant retesting that doesn’t improve safety. Riders gain sufficient experience in two years to handle larger bikes. It also highlights the benefits of post-EU regulatory flexibility, streamlining licensing while supporting environmental and public sector goals.
